Avocado Toast with Poached Eggs
Pamela D.

Atmosphere good and clean.Everyone was nice and greeted us with a good morning or hello and a smile. Our waiter was great, super nice, wish I remembered his name. Food was served on big white plates and didn't have much space on our table. Food was good. I got avocado toast with poached eggs cooked perfectly. Avocado was fresh and tasty. I also got a lemon ricotta pancake with blueberries. Liked that I could taste the lemon, woulda liked a little more lemon and maybe ricotta on top. Teens got eggs and pancakes. Daughter got gluten free pancakes and said they were good and fluffy which is rare for her to say. Home fries weren't seasoned but not the main dish so didn't matter just a filler. My husband said his meat omelette was packed with meat and didn't disappoint. Bathrooms were clean which I always appreciate.

We arrived at around noon on Saturday, torn between breakfast & lunch, and with our dog in tow. We…read moresat at a cute little two top outside with room for the dog to spread out without infringing any other guests. The setting continues to be cute and comfortable. M. ordered the Wagyu burger with matchstick fries & I got the New Zealand Classic breakfast with chicken sausage. Waters were brought out quickly for us, including Cali. I later ordered a mimosa & it came out quickly as well. There's a special on mimosas on Saturday & Sunday from 10-2. They start at $1 at 10am and the price goes up incrementally until 2pm when they're $9. (My mimosa was $6.) The food took a bit longer, about twenty minutes, to be delivered. I liked my breakfast very much. Everything was tasty & I enjoyed having little bits of different things to nosh on. M. said his burger was very good, he only wished that it was a bit bigger for the price. Service was fine & friendly. Overall, this was a pleasant experience. Great people watching and great weather helped to enhance this brunch even more. Peace.
